Wade Around or Fly Fish at the Provo River

The Provo River is a premier blue ribbon trout fishery nearby Summit Creek. The river makes for the perfect summer playground. Catch and release alongside some of the best fly fishers in the state, set up a tent for the weekend and enjoy access to the river at any time, or grab a few friends and head down the river in a rafting experience that will put your endurance to the test—the possibilities are endless.

Explore Utah Lake

Just 20 minutes away from Summit Creek lies Utah Lake, one of the most serene places in the state. Spanning over 95,000 acres, Utah Lake has an endless number of things to do. If you love to hike and explore nature, visit Utah Lake State Park for views and trails that make most hike-lovers’ bucket lists. If you want to have a relaxing view of the lake, you can rent a boat and tour around the expansive lake at your leisure, or enjoy water sports like tubing, wakeboarding, and waterskiing. Utah Lake is full of opportunities for the whole family.
